Transaction 8c01e84ec11f12236314a58ff24b5ab14cc2bc10ee3d4394665cdf60f956793e
1 Input
1 Output
-
8c01e84ec11f12236314a58ff24b5ab14cc2bc10ee3d4394665cdf60f956793e:0
- value
- 8658956
- script pubkey
- OP_0 OP_PUSHBYTES_32 da7d446b9aad68624c0381e37f4f3238ca8b33ee5cc2ca7e3e1e8da1b090b77c
- address
- bc1qmf75g6u6445xynqrs83h7nej8r9gkvlwtnpv5l37r6x6rvyska7qyj2yzq